UML, Unified Modeling Language
· 4 min read
UML 개념
- SW산출물을 가시화, 명세화, 구축, 문서화하는 도구로 구조, 동작, 인터랙션 다이어그램으로 구분
시퀀스 다이어그램, 커뮤니케이션 다이어그램 구성도, 구성요소, 절차
시퀀스 다이어그램, 커뮤니케이션 다이어그램 구성도 비교
- 시퀀스 다이어그램은 시간 순서에 따라, 커뮤니케이션 다이어그램은 구조에 따라 인터렉션 표현
시퀀스 다이어그램, 커뮤니케이션 다이어그램 구성요소 비교
구분 | 시퀀스 | 커뮤니케이션 |
---|---|---|
개념 | 객체 간 상호작용을 시간 흐름에 따라 메세지 표현 | 객체 간 메세지의 구조적 구성 표현 |
핵심요소 | 라이프라인, 액티베이션박스, 메세지 | 객체, 링크, 메세지 |
사례 | 시스템 내부 프로세스, 실행 순서 | 시스템 아키텍처 개념적 이해 |